JavaScript Injection in SEO: What It Is, Risks, and How to Protect Your Website

  Search engine optimization (SEO) is all about making your website more visible to users and search engines. But as we build faster, more interactive websites with JavaScript, we also open the door to new vulnerabilities—like JavaScript injection . This isn’t just a security issue; it can hurt your SEO, user experience, and even your website’s reputation. Let’s break it down. What Is JavaScript Injection? JavaScript Injection is a type of code injection attack where malicious JavaScript is inserted into a website’s code—often through insecure forms, URLs, or cookies. Once executed in the browser, this script can: Steal user data Redirect visitors to spammy or harmful websites Alter on-page content (like inserting links or ads) Hijack SEO efforts by injecting hidden keywords or links Why It Matters for SEO While JavaScript injection is primarily a security concern , it has serious SEO consequences too. SEO for E-commerce: Strategies to Boost Online Sales

 In today’s digital landscape, SEO is a crucial factor for the success of e-commerce businesses. With the right strategies, you can improve your search engine rankings, drive organic traffic, and increase conversions. This blog will explore key SEO techniques tailored for e-commerce websites. 1. Keyword Research for E-commerce Effective keyword research helps you understand what potential customers are searching for. Best Practices: Use long-tail keywords that indicate purchase intent (e.g., "buy running shoes online"). Analyze competitor keywords with tools like Ahrefs, SEMrush, or Google Keyword Planner . Optimize for category pages and product descriptions with relevant keywords. 2. Optimizing Product Pages Each product page should be fully optimized to improve rankings and conversions. SEO for Voice Search: How to Optimize for the Future of Search

  Voice search is transforming the way people interact with search engines. With the rise of virtual assistants like Google Assistant, Siri, and Alexa, optimizing for voice search is essential to staying ahead in the SEO game. This blog will explore key strategies to help your website rank higher in voice search results. 1. Understanding Voice Search Behavior Voice searches are different from traditional text-based searches. They are more conversational and often framed as questions. Key Trends: Users prefer natural language and long-tail keywords . Voice searches are often location-based (e.g., "near me" searches). People expect quick and accurate answers . 2. Targeting Conversational Keywords Optimizing for voice search means focusing on natural, conversational queries. SEO for Video Content: How to Rank Your Videos on Search Engines

  Video content is one of the most engaging forms of digital media, and optimizing it for search engines is crucial for visibility. With platforms like YouTube being the second-largest search engine, implementing the right SEO strategies can significantly boost your video rankings. In this blog, we’ll explore key techniques to optimize your video content for SEO success. 1. Choosing the Right Keywords for Video SEO Keywords play a vital role in how search engines understand and rank your video content. Best Practices: Use video-specific keywords (e.g., "how-to tutorials" or "best fitness exercises"). Conduct research using tools like YouTube’s Search Suggest, Google Trends, and Ahrefs .
